OK - so I got points taken off at the MCA show in Springfield for having a chip in my windshield (way down at the bottom center about an inch above the bottom of the glass - looks just like a 'BB" hit it if you know what that looks like). I never noticed it much, and hoped they would overlook it - they didnt.
So, I decide to have Safelite come out and fix it. No big problem I say to myself - I have done this 2 times before with my '55 Chevy - so it can be done easily. But, yesterday they screwed up and it now looks worse - instead of a clear chip, it is now a chip with haze about the size of a pea.
Anybody have this happen before? They said once the epoxy cures, there is nothing else to do but buy a new windshield. Carlite windshields are hard to find - but I found them for $220 not including shipping or install - a chunk of $ just to deal with a chip.
Anyone have trouble with window repair before? This was my first problem, and they were surprised it didnt work. Now it is too late to fix, but it is the original windshield.
